Dhaka: Inspector General of Police (IGP) Baharul Alam BPM today urged police personnel to intensify their efforts in combating crime. 'We have to work with honesty and stay on the path of justice. We have to make 100 percent efforts to stop extortion, robbery and murder,' he stated during a monthly crime review meeting held at the Bangladesh Police Auditorium in Rajarbagh.

According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, the police chief emphasized the need for professionalism in suppressing crimes such as extortion and drug abuse. The meeting was presided over by Dhaka Metropolitan Police (DMP) Commissioner SM Sajjat Ali, who advocated for a zero tolerance policy against robbers and extortionists. 'Robbers and extortionists should be arrested. DMP police stations should play a more active role in this regard. Everyone should perform their professional duties with a sense of responsibility and enthusiasm. If everyone works together, the people's full trust in the police will return,' he added.

At the meeting, the DMP Commissioner recognized the efforts of various DMP officers by awarding them in different categories for their exemplary work in maintaining law and order as well as public safety in Dhaka Metropolitan City in December.
